How Our Team Approaches Broken Pipe Water Removal
With Broken Pipe Water Removal, our team follows a meticulous process to ensure the job is done right. We start by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the leak. From there, our technicians work to extract water from the affected area using our state-of-the-art equipment. We then dry the area thoroughly to prevent mold growth and structural damage. Throughout the process, our team keeps you informed of our progress and ensures you’re comfortable and safe in your home.
Assessment and Leak Detection
Our team begins by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the leak. This involves inspecting the affected area to find out the extent of the damage and the best course of action to take. Our technicians are trained to detect even the smallest leaks and will work tirelessly to identify the root cause of the issue.
Water Extraction
Once the source of the leak is identified, our team gets to work extracting water from the affected area. We use advanced equipment to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.
Drying and Moisture Removal
After the water is extracted, our team focuses on drying and moisture removal. We use spec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from the affected area, preventing mold growth and structural damage.
Dehumidification and Air Purification
Finally, our team sets up dehumidification equipment to remove any remaining moisture from the air and purify the air to prevent mold growth and bacteria proliferation.

Warning Signs You Need Broken Pipe Water Removal
Catching the signs of a pipe burst early can save you a lot of money and prevent further damage to your property. Here are some common warning signs you should look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, musty odors in your home can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. If you notice these odors persisting, it’s time to call our team to investigate and provide a solution.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can show a leak somewhere in your roof or walls. If you notice these stains, don’t ignore them, call our team to inspect and repair the damage before it’s too late.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or a hidden leak. If you notice these symptoms, don’t wait, call our team to inspect and repair the damage before it’s too late.
High Water Bills
High water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. If you notice your water bills increasing suddenly, it’s time to call our team to investigate and provide a solution.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age in your home can be a sign of a pipe burst or leak. If you notice any signs of water damage, don’t wait, call our team to inspect and repair the damage quickly and efficiently.
Broken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a bathroom sink | Yes | No | DIY fixes are usually enough for small leaks. |
| Large area of water damage in a living room | No | Yes |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le large water damage incidents. |
| Hidden leak behind a wall | No | Yes | Professionals have the tools and expertise to detect hidden leaks. |
| Water damage caused by a burst pipe in a kitchen | No | Yes |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le high-pressure water damage incidents. |
| Water damage caused by a flood in a basement | No | Yes |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le large water damage incidents. |
| Water damage caused by a leak in a roof | No | Yes | Professionals have the tools and expertise to detect hidden leaks and repair roof damage. |

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ost In Walls, MS
The cost of Broken Pipe Water Removal in Walls, MS can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age. |
| Drying and Moisture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of moisture present. |
| Dehumidification and Air Purification |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of moisture present. |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. |
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$100 – $500 | The urgency of the situation and the complexity of the assessment. |
| Free Estimate and Consultation | Free | No more costs or obligations. |
The final cost of Broken Pipe Water Removal in Walls, MS will depend on the specific services needed and the size of the affected area. Can I prevent Broken Pipe Water Removal from happening in the first place?
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ent Broken Pipe Water Removal from happening in the first place. Here are a few tips:
Regularly inspect your pipes for signs of wear and tear.
Make sure to turn off the water supply to your home during extended periods of non-use.
Use a water sensor to detect hidden leaks and alert you to potential problems.
Consider installing a pipe insulation system to protect your pipes from freezing temperatures.
